NEW RELEASES: Fantasia 'Back To Me,' Usher 'Versus,' R. City 'Wake The Neighbors'

After a whirlwind two weeks, which included an alleged sex-tape and an attempted suicide, Fantasia stuck to the plan at hand and released her third album 'Back To Me.
' The disc is lead by the singles "Bittersweet" and "Man the House," which were both received well by fans.

Usher extends the life of his hit platinum album Raymond V. Raymond with the release of his 'Versus' EP, which includes seven new songs that will also be included on 'Raymond v. Raymond' deluxe edition. The disc will explores the subjects of being newly single and a father over production by Jim Jonsin, Rico Love, Drumma Boy, Jimmy Jam and Terry Lewis and Tha Cornaboyz. Jay-Z, Bun B., Pitbull and good buddy Justin Bieber are also featured on the album.

St. Thomas duo Timothy and Theron Thomasin, best know as R. City, drops their debut album after being discovered by Akon in 2006. The disc blends Caribbean & R&B with singing, rapping, and songwriting by the duo.
